""History Of The One Hundred And Fiftieth Regiment, Pennsylvania Volunteers, Second Regiment, Bucktail Brigade"" is a book written by Thomas Chamberlin in 1905. It is a detailed account of the 150th Regiment of Pennsylvania Volunteers, which was a part of the Bucktail Brigade during the American Civil War. The book covers the regiment's formation, its role in various battles, and its ultimate disbandment. It also includes biographical sketches of the officers and soldiers who served in the regiment, as well as numerous illustrations and maps.
